Closure is the 12th official Nine Inch Nails release. It consists of music videos interspersed with snippets from educational films, as well as exclusive footage shot by Peter Christopherson including antics by Nine Inch Nails and their tour guests: Marilyn Manson, Jim Rose Circus and David Bowie. Originally scheduled to be released on DVD in 2004, the disc appeared on internet torrent sites in 2006, including behind-the-scenes footage of the "Closer" video with commentary by Mark Romanek. Fans speculate that Reznor may have been the source of this leak.

The Wiñoy Xipantv is the turnaround of the year for the Mapuche People. It's a space of celebration, encounter, thought, religiousness and fight. It occurs in june, in the middle of the winter, when the 'mapu' (land) starts to reborn and the longest night lets the sun come in.
